django - 修改 自增长id,起始值

常常你会遇到这样的情况,需要自增长的起始值是 0,再次从 0开始。

两个选择:

1.

drop table_name;

django重新建表。

2.

ALTER TABLE table_name AUTO_INCREMENT=66666;

好吧,我一直粗暴解决问题了很久,NO.2方法明显优雅许多~

今天群里朋友问起来了,顺便一下啊

django - 修改 自增长id,起始值

时间: 2024-10-16 16:07:07

django - 修改 自增长id,起始值的相关文章

使用命令设置MySQL数据表自增ID起始值

使用命令设置MySQL数据表自增ID起始值技术 maybe yes 发表于2015-01-24 16:14 原文链接 : http://blog.lmlphp.com/archives/68  来自 : LMLPHP后院 有 时候我们清空了 MySQL 数据库中数据表的记录,自动增长的 ID 值变的很大,如何将自动增长的 ID 值设置为1或者修改为其他的值呢?使用一些工具,比如 NaviCat for MySQL 当然非常简单,通过在设计表处修改即可,其他的一些工具也都很简单.下面给出使用 SQ

Mysql自增ID起始值修改

在mysql中很多朋友都认为字段为AUTO_INCREMENT类型自增ID值是无法修改,其实这样理解是错误的,下面介绍mysql自增ID的起始值修改与设置方法.通常的设置自增字段的方法:创建表格时添加: create table table1(id int auto_increment primary key,...) 创建表格后添加: alter table table1 add id int auto_increment primary key 自增字段,一定要设置为primary key.

MySQL自增ID 起始值 修改方法

在mysql中很多朋友都认为字段为AUTO_INCREMENT类型自增ID值是无法修改,其实这样理解是错误的,下面介绍mysql自增ID的起始值修改与设置方法. 通常的设置自增字段的方法: 创建表格时添加: create table table1(id int auto_increment primary key,...) 创建表格后添加: alter table table1 add id int auto_increment primary key 自增字段 一定要设置为primary ke

mysql自增ID起始值修改方法

在mysql中很多朋友都认为字段为AUTO_INCREMENT类型自增ID值是无法修改,其实这样理解是错误的,下面介绍mysql自增ID的起始值修改与设置方法. 通常的设置自增字段的方法: 创建表格时添加: create table table1(id int auto_increment primary key,...) 创建表格后添加: alter table table1 add id int auto_increment primary key 自增字段,一定要设置为primary ke

Mysql 设置id起始值

alter table t_tszj_pet_activity AUTO_INCREMENT=10000;   设置 id 从10000 开始 原文地址:https://www.cnblogs.com/gjh99/p/10898986.html

sql修改自增长ID

ALTER PROCEDURE [sp_Table_SetIdentity] @Table varchar(100) ,@Schema varchar(100) AS BEGIN DECLARE @vSQL nvarchar(max) -- drop PK on [SchoolID] SET @vSQL = N' ALTER TABLE #Schema#.#Table# DROP CONSTRAINT PK_#Table#; ' SET @vSQL = Replace(@vSQL, '#Tabl

自增的起始值 、 步长

修改自增的起始值: 修改一个表id自增的起始值就是让他们可以直接跳到每一个我们想要的起始值 比如:这样可以直接从1调到20插入 Alter table +表名 Auto_increment = 你想要设置的从第几位开始的id Alter table t1 auto_increment = 20;这个是把你的要自增的id设置从20开始增加 但是只可以增大你的设置的id 步长: 不仅仅可以设置自增的起始值还可以设置增加的步长 你在设置自增的值的时候其实也可以设置步长增加的  但是mysql的自增步长

Mybatis自增长id处理

目录 1.使用useGenerateKey 2.使用select LAST_INSERT_ID() 3.使用select @@IDENTITY 4.在MySql中模拟Sequence 参考: 1.使用useGenerateKey <insert id="insert" parameterType="Person" useGeneratedKeys="true" keyProperty="personId"> ins

mysql 约束条件 auto_increment 自动增长起始值 布长 起始偏移量

我们指定一个字段为自动增长,他默认从1开始自动增长,默认值为1,每次增长为1,步长为1 模糊查询 like % 代表任意个数字符 任意字符长度 查看mysql正在使用变量 show variables like “auto_inc%” mysql> show variables like "auto_inc%" ; +--------------------------+-------+ | Variable_name | Value | +-------------------